Posted by: Greg914-6GT Sep 26 2017, 03:13 AM

Sebring has taken a toll on the suspension. Zotz's Racing is meticulously prepping my car for Daytona and fixing rear suspension and body cracks. They are adding some structural reinforcement and building a new swing arm that catastrophicly failed at Sebring. Nothing was found in the three oil filters, so just a valve adjustment and torque the heads was needed. Trans is being gone through and M,S,X gears are being swapped in. I would invite people to the testing October 6-8, but it's a private event. Hope to see you at Daytona in November. Attached Image Attached Image
